EA Launches Find All Five for Battlefield: Bad Company

Planet Battlefield writes: "Last Friday, Planet Battlefield was invited to the Battlefield: Bad Company Community Day at EA in Redwood City, California. This was actually my first chance I had to play the game, which appeared to be very solid and fun despite not being used to Xbox 360 controllers. Thanks to the guys at EA and DICE for putting together a great event! Keep checking back for more community day features throughout the week.

EA will offer 5 different ways to gain 5 unlocks via FindAllFive.com. This site will tell you how to obtain your unlock codes and then how to redeem them.
